Responsibilities

  • Manage a complex and demanding calendar and travel schedule, routinely planning, coordinating and scheduling meetings across multiple time zones.
  • Act as a strategic gatekeeper for the COO's time — prioritising requests, ensuring alignment with key priorities, and diplomatically declining or redirecting lower-value commitments.
  • Arrange business travel, prepare detailed itineraries and country engagement plans, and process expenses efficiently in Concur.
  • Confidently liaise with senior executives, customers, partners, and relevant external stakeholders.
  • Serve as a trusted liaison between the COO, direct reports, and the wider organisation — representing the Digital & Innovation Office with professionalism and discretion.
  • Continuously review, categorise, and action inbox items on behalf of the COO where appropriate.
  • Propose and implement an inbox management approach including automation rules and filtering to maximise focus.
  • Maintain communication channels (Outlook, Teams, Viva Engage, LinkedIn) and surface critical information in a timely and structured way to keep the COO informed and prepared.
  • Develop meeting materials including background research, participant profiles, previous commitments, and suggested discussion points. Prepare briefing packs ahead of key meetings.
  • Organise and execute meetings, distribute actions, and follow up on commitments to accelerate executive decision-making.
  • Prepare exec summaries following key meetings based off of recordings and transcripts.
  • Plan and organise all hands meetings and high-profile external engagements. Manage venue, catering, AV/video conferencing, IT setup, and security access.
  • Support the setup of Zoom webinars as required, host all hands and town hall meetings.
  • Provide support and program management for strategic projects, employee engagement initiatives, and Digital & Innovation Office programmes. Coordinate special projects and department-wide events, like all hands, town halls, and support slide deck creation.
  • Raise purchase orders and manage approvals using Coupa. Facilitate timely approval of invoices for payment. Maintain accurate records of procurement activity.
  • Manage delegated approvals across systems and workflows, ensuring appropriate documentation and escalation where required. Track follow-ups on approvals, signatures, and responses to maintain momentum.
  • Review and manage all travel and expense approvals on behalf of the executive, while using strong judgement regarding approvals and notifications, and discretion.
